Address
3191 ADAMS AVE
92116 SAN DIEGO
Phone
+1 619-280-0331
Car Tire dealers in 3191 ADAMS AVE, 92116 SAN DIEGO
1441 CAMINO DEL RIO S
92108 SAN DIEGO
750 CAMINO DEL RIO N
92108 SAN DIEGO
777 CAMINO DEL RIO S
92108 SAN DIEGO
650 GATEWAY CENTER DR
92102 SAN DIEGO
3865 CONVOY ST
92111 SAN DIEGO
6336 COLLEGE GROVE WAY
92115 SAN DIEGO
4660 RUFFNER
92111 SAN DIEGO